Exploring the Benefits of an Insulin Resistance Mediterranean Diet


The Mediterranean diet has been gaining popularity in recent years as a way to manage insulin resistance. Often referred to as a ‘heart-healthy’ diet, it is known for its regular intake of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, legumes and healthy fats. But what does this type of diet have to offer when it comes to managing insulin resistance?



Studies have shown that following a Mediterranean diet can actually reduce the risk of developing diabetes or pre-diabetes by up to 28%. The reason being is that this style of eating helps to balance blood sugar levels due to its high fiber content and the fact that it focuses on low glycemic index foods. Additionally, the healthy fats found in olive oil and fish are beneficial in helping to improve insulin sensitivity.



Not only is an insulin resistance Mediterranean diet beneficial for helping with blood sugar concerns but there are other benefits associated with following this type of meal plan as well. Studies show that individuals who follow this type of eating pattern tend to be less likely to develop heart disease due to its emphasis on healthy fats and limiting processed foods. Another perk is that it has been linked with improved cognitive functioning as well as reducing inflammation throughout the body.
